Abstract

The superplastic behavior of cast and hot-extruded NiAl-28Cr-6Mo is observed in the strain rates between ε̇ = 1.04 × 10-3 and 5.02 × 10-2 s-1 at 1323-1373 K. The synchronous operation of dislocation glide and dynamic recovery is responsible for the tested alloy to exhibit superplastic behavior.
